Key Features
- Feather-Light Design: Despite its massive 16-inch display, it maintains the legendary “gram” portability, making it one of the lightest 2-in-1s in its class.
- Intel Core Ultra 7 Processor: Harnesses advanced AI-ready performance for seamless multitasking and efficient power management.
- 360-Degree Versatility: A durable hinge allows you to switch instantly between laptop, tablet, tent, and stand modes.
- Intel Evo Edition: Guarantees high standards for battery life, instant wake, and fast connectivity for a premium user experience.
- Spacious 1TB SSD: Offers lightning-fast boot times and massive storage for high-resolution projects and multimedia libraries.

Pros & Cons
- Pros:
- Incredibly lightweight for a 16-inch device, reducing shoulder and back strain.
- Vibrant, responsive touchscreen that is perfect for digital artists and designers.
- Long-lasting battery life that easily handles a full workday of mixed usage.
- Cons:
- The ultra-light chassis may feel less “solid” compared to heavy, thick workstations.
- Integrated graphics are excellent for productivity but not meant for high-end 4K gaming.
- The premium 2-in-1 design comes at a higher price point than standard non-touch laptops.
